Window handles are available in different sizes and styles. But, the primary feature is that all are designed to fit the same type espagnolette bolts that are found on uPVC or timber windows. This allows you to easily upgrade your windows by replacing the handles with a modern design. You can also find tilt and turn handles that meet Secure by Design requirements.
You can choose between a variety of locking options and finishes to match the design. Some of these include the push-button to lock in a closed' position, as well as key-locking (and fire escape non-locking where needed). You can select between either a cranked or inline handle. The former will give you more room for your hands against the window, whereas the latter is more tidy.

Espag handles are usually found on uPVC windows and are available in two options that are in-line and cranked. In-line handles are straight and can turn right or left, and are sometimes called universal window handles. Cranked handles can be left- or right-handed and have one small piece of curved material on the back.
